I had my first experience of a low cost carrier last night. Flew on Fly Baboo from Nice to Geneva. Started by asking the BA desk for a lounge invitation as I have a Gold card. No problem. Lounge very quiet, staffed by Servisair, no problems, lots of choice. Bussed out to this very clean Embraer 190, wider seats than BA Club Europe (a 2+2 arrangement), more space between them. I was in Row 6; the front 5 rows had even more space between seats. Free refreshments of water, a beef roll and a small tiramisu - all this on a 50 minute flight. Had to wait 15 minutes for bags, but it only cost €45. It wasn't very full, but there were 3 cabin crew, who were polite and attentive.

On the basis of that flight, I'll try Fly Baboo again, although if they don't get better load factors, I don't know how long they will last.
